Choosing enhanced metal or fiberglass door structures guarantees architectural stability throughout thermal events.Developing Defensible Space in Coastal Residential SetupsEstablishing defensible area around a Santa Monica residential or commercial property lowers direct fire direct exposure and reduces readily available fuel near the main house. Zone-based landscape preparation arranges outdoor locations to reduce fire progression while protecting lavish coastal landscape design objectives. Property owners can integrate hardscaping attributes with drought-tolerant, fire-retardant plant species to balance visual style with functional security.Just How Should Homeowner Structure Home Ignition Zones?House owners have to maintain a zero-ignition zone prolonging 5 feet of the structure using gravel, concrete pavers, or stone ornamental rock. The prompt five-foot border should remain entirely without flammable compost, wood fence, or thick plant life. The second protection area, expanding thirty feet from the home, calls for low-growing plants, well-irrigated turf, and widely spaced trees. Removing dead organic matter continuously keeps gas degrees marginal throughout both areas.Which Indigenous Plant Kingdoms Support Fire Resistance and Coastal Appeal?Fire-retardant plants feature high wetness content, low sap volume, and marginal fallen leave losing throughout seasonal environment shifts. Species such as agave, succulent varieties, The golden state lavender, and ingrained groundcovers take in heat without igniting quickly. Staying clear of resinous plants like eucalyptus, ache, and decorative turfs avoids rapid fire spread out near living areas.
